We stayed two nights here coming from Cantania , we were driving and when we got to Ortigia the medieval district driving became impossible to reach the hotel by car , the streets were to narrow . We had to park near the waterfront take our luggage to the hotel , then park the car in a overnight car park and walk back to out hotel a half mile away . This building was not originally a hotel but was a home in the 1500’s during the Spanish Inquisition. When the Spanish came the original building housed Jewish baths underground that were built in the 5-6 th century . They sealed off the baths and built above them . The Jews left for Northern Africa and Northern Europe and abandoned Siracusa. The building became abandoned as well until 1986 , when someone bought the building to convert it into a hotel. That is when they found the underground Jewish Baths , unsealed them and now gives tours . Imagine from the 1500’s until 1986 these ancient Jewish Baths were just sitting there under water . They now have a system to drain the water that comes from underground springs so that it doesn’t flood. The place is charming , the rooms are nice size luckily we had a room on the 1st floor. The room floor is uneven and has a small ledge which can really cause injury if you are not careful. The hotel is centrally located in the Medieval section of Siracusa near sights , the water , churches ( the Huge Duomo ) shopping , and many very good restaurants . The front desk closes in the middle of the day for a few hours and so does the underground tour. Friendly staff , when we needed more towels they were very accommodating. Everything is within walking distance even the Archeological sites . The breakfast room is okk the usual continental breakfast but will make omelets and cappuccino. It was satisfying and kept us full until lunch . . The ambience is really nice , we enjoyed our stay here . BUT remember there is NO parking . Street parking which is around on the water side is reserved for residences only . You have no choice but to use the parking garage $15 per 24 hours , which I thought was very reasonable. I would recommend this hotel if you really want to immerse yourself in medieval culture .

With a stay at Alla Giudecca in Syracuse (Ortigia), you'll be steps from Lungomare di Ortigia and Jewish Bath. This family-friendly residence is 7.1 mi (11.5 km) from Arenella Beach and 10.9 mi (17.5 km) from Fontane Bianche Beach.

Take in the views from a terrace and a garden and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access. Additional features at this residence include babysitting (surcharge), a hair salon, and wedding services.

You can enjoy a meal at the restaurant serving the guests of Alla Giudecca, or stop in at the snack bar/deli.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. Buffet breakfasts are available daily from 8:00 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ee.

Featured amenities include a business center, luggage storage, and a safe deposit box at the front desk. A roundtrip airport shuttle is available for a surcharge.

Make yourself at home in one of the 7 air-conditioned rooms featuring kitchenettes. Satellite television is provided for your entertainment. Conveniences include desks and separate sitting areas, and housekeeping is provided daily.
